Is FedEx Ground and FedEx freight the same company?

FedEx Corporation branches to FedEx Express, FedEx Ground, FedEx Freight, FedEx Logistics, FedEx Office and FedEx Services. FedEx Express branches to FedEx Custom Critical and FedEx Cross Border. FedEx Logistics branches to FedEx Forward Depots, FedEx Supply Chain and FedEx Trade Networks Transport and Brokerage.

What is considered FedEx freight?

Any shipment over 150 lbs. is considered freight. Freight shipping is the transportation of goods, commodities and cargo in bulk by ship, aircraft, truck or intermodal via train and road.

Is freight the same as shipping?

Both shipping and freight are the transportation of goods either by air, land, or sea. Although shipping and freight are both used to describe the bulk transportation of goods, freight always refers to a larger quantity of goods while shipping can refer to a smaller amount.

Why does FedEx Palletize their freight shipments?

The use of a pallet or handling base in LTL shipments is preferred for handling efficiency and safety, to reduce product damage and to maintain package orientation.

What is the difference between freight prepaid and freight collect?

In simple terms, Freight Collect means that the consignee or receiver is responsible for the freight charges. Similarly, Freight Prepaid denotes that the shipping charges are the responsibility of the shipper or consignor. These charges, along with any other ancillary expenses, are also referred to as ‘Prepaid & add’.

What is the difference between FedEx Express and FedEx Ground?

While the Express service above is a “day definite” (meaning that the customer is promised which day the package will arrive based on the service they select), FedEx Ground does not promise a specific day. FedEx Ground tends to a bit cheaper than even the 3 day Express service (Express Saver).

How many countries does FedEx Express cover?

FedEx Express covers every U.S. street address and services more than 220 countries and territories. Our global network provides time-sensitive, air-ground express service through more than 650 airports worldwide. Check out FedEx Express services and explore the company FedEx Express history.
